Subject: [release] SplitGate assignment svc — rollout tonight

On-call: SplitGate v3.9 goes out at 22:00. Changes: bucket hashing moved to murmur-based scheme, stale assignment cache TTL dropped to 5m. Watch for assignment flapping on the Kestrel dashboard for the first hour. Rollback is one click via the deploy console; do not hand-edit configs. Experiment owners have been notified. If you page anyone, include the canary trace token printed below.

pipeline stamp: htk4_ae36

## Alert: StatRelay Sidecar Flush Lag

This alert fires when the StatRelay metrics-aggregation sidecar falls more than 120 seconds behind on flushing buffered samples to the Coalmine backend. Plugin-emitted counters are buffered in-process, so sustained lag usually means a plugin is emitting unbounded label cardinality or blocking the flush thread. Check your plugin's metric registration against the published cardinality limits before escalating. If the lag persists after your plugin is ruled out, contact the telemetry team.

escalation mailbox, bagug-fahof: novdor.wendor.jormir@norvalabs.example

Runbook entry: Key-card stock for the new Drellmont Annex site arrives Thursday via Caskin Transit. The driver's coordinator must confirm the sealed carton count against the manifest from Ovanta Systems and hold the stock in the secure cage until site activation. For this shipment, the courier hand-over must follow the instruction below.

dispatch memo: the quenax olidor courier leaves the lamvan aldath keliel ledger at gate 2085 under passcode 005795

TICKET: Weekly cash-box run missed, Thursday slot. Courier from Varnell Transit never showed at dock 2. Box remains in the Drennick Supply cage, sealed. Reschedule for tomorrow 09:00, same dock. Shift lead to confirm seal intact before release. The replacement courier must be given the following hand-over instruction verbatim.

handover note for yagef-bagep: the drudor pelius courier leaves the kasdor zorvan norir ledger at gate 8016 under passcode 755406